Senior Architect Resume
Washington, DC
PROFESSIONAL SUMMARY:
- 18 years of total experience in designing, developing, deploying, integrating quality software applications with 8 plus years as Senior Architect.
- Resourceful, creative problem - solver with proven aptitude to analyze and translate complex customer requirements and business problems and design/implement innovative custom solutions.
- Excellent communication, presentation, Facilitation and documentation skills.
- Possess excellent organizational, inter-personal and communication skills. Proven self-starter and capable of working on multiple modules.
- Ability to work with both senior management level executives and development teams.
- Certified with Microsoft and Oracle. Trained on BigData architecture from Hortonworks.
- Strong implementation knowledge of Object-Oriented Analysis and Design using agile methodologies.
- Design, develop and implement database systems. Optimize database systems for performance efficiency.
- Good implementation knowledge of Unit testing frameworks and open source projects.
- Experience in Section 508 (accessibility) Testing, Test Automation, Software Testing, Help Desk
- Knowledge on design patterns - extensively used in architecting and developing applications.
- Five years of experience in SOA architecture, having implementation experience of Web Services.
- Experience in designing applications on MVC & Entity Frameworks, CMS and portals.
- Experience in Web Analytics and streaming solutions using Media Frameworks.
TECHNICAL SKILLS:
Cloud Technologies: AWS Cloud Formation, Azure, Server-less Architecture
AWS Resources: VPC, ELB, RDS, Route 53, EMR, Dynamo DB, Athena, Lambda
Services Orchestration: TIBCO, Bolt, Azure Automation
Containers Mgmt.: ECS, Docker Swarm, Kubernetes
Application Srvs. /IOT: Web Logic, WebSphere, Tomcat, JBoss, OAS, Mobile
Configuration Mgmt.: Ansible, Puppet, Chef, Git, Jenkins
Databases: Oracle, MongoDB, SQL Server, Postgres, Greenplum
IDE: JBuilder, Eclipse, WSAD, RAD, RSA
Languages: Java, Perl, PHP, Python, R, Node.js, MATLAB, Shell
Scripting Languages: JavaScript, Angular, Shell script, JQuery, DOJO
Big Data Tools: Cloudera, Hortonworks, Spark, Storm, Cassandra, Kafka
Monitoring Tools: Splunk, Loggly, Solr, Logstash, Kibana, Nagios, Terraform
Web Technologies: ASP, JSP, Servlets, Angular, D3, SOA, Web services
Open Source: Apache resources, Spring, Alfresco
Analytic Tools: Tableau, SAS, QlikView
PROFESSIONAL EXPERIENCE:
Confidential, Washington, DC
Senior Architect
Responsibilities:
- Participate in team planning sessions.
- Analyze existing information systems to develop opportunities for improvements. Evaluate and provide recommendations for new/expanded workflows. Lead or participate on cross-functional teams to implement the improvements.
- Adhere to quality standards and procedures. Maintain quality assurance for software modules, comply with application & team standards, and conduct duration stability testing of modules to verify the requirements.
- Develop, enhance and maintain system integration.
- Splunk infrastructure with high available capacity planning and optimization configuration, Splunk forwarder deployment, scripted to automate various aspects of the Splunk environment, Automated operational tasks
- Document functions and changes to new or modified features/modules, test activities/results and other areas such as error handling.
- Enhance and monitor operation, performance, & security monitoring (including logging). Identify new tools, processes, and to improve team efficiency.
- Work as part of a team to manage multiple activities with conflicting priorities in an organized manner to achieve results.
Environment: TIBCO, IBM, Linux, Perl, Python, Java, Splunk, Solr, Shell scripting, Performance Analytics, Integration
Confidential, Reston, VA
Lead Architect
Responsibilities:
- Installed and configured Cloudera distribution with Hadoop on the CloudEC2 Cluster (AWS).
- Configured Oracle database to store Hive metadata.
- Loaded unstructured data into Hadoop File System (HDFS).
- Created ETL jobs to load JSON data and server data into Hadoop.
- Created reports and dashboards using structured and unstructured data.
Environment: Amazon AWS, Cloudera, Hadoop2, HDFS, YARN, Map-Reduce, Hive, Impala, Pig, Spark, Zookeeper
Confidential, Washington, DC
Sr. Consultant
Responsibilities:
- Designed and developed a REST-ful style Web Services layer and an AJAX front end.
- Designed and built a user discussion portlet to work inside Orchard Portal. Exposed the interface through a push to Blackberry users. Used Forum and plain XML web services.
- Built screens with MVC, CSS, Dojo, and custom JavaScript.
- Designed and built document tracking/workflow system with HTML, CSS and JavaScript, JQuery, JSON, and a REST architecture.
- Designed and built HTML front end to Oracle database.
- Participate in database design and architecture to support application development.
- Developed functions, scripts, stored procedures and triggers to support application development.
- Developed security procedures to protect databases from unauthorized usage.
- Built tracking system consuming XML feeds and converting them to a single standard HTML format.
- Built web-based maintenance application to maintain complex specification documents.
- Contributed to development of Enterprise Application Integration (EAI) software and used it to convert proprietary data formats to and from standard XML formats. Involved working with Oracle databases. Exposed various capabilities as Web Services using SOAP/WSDL.
- Developed thin-client Customer Relation Management (CRM) system in MVC Framework.
Environment: UNIX/Windows Servers, Oracle, Java, Rational Clear Case, Clear Quest, PERL, Verity Search Engine, AJAX, Lucene/Solr, NETAPP
Confidential, Washington, DC
Journeyman Programmer
Responsibilities:
- Project lead
- Analyze, design, and code new websites integrated with back-end systems
- Support existing e-commerce websites
- Identify, recommend, and prioritize new features and applications
- Assist in configuration of web and database servers
- Perform periodic website audits
- Ensure security of all websites
- Architected and oversaw the creation of a system of web services connecting the company’s Commerce Server websites with their ERP system giving the websites real-time pricing, inventory, and order integration
- Designed a new checkout process, which utilized web technologies and reduced checkout steps from seven to two. The new process greatly reduced abandonment rates
- Analyzed website performance and identified areas of improvement which when implemented reduced CPU utilization on all website servers and database servers increasing the number of requests able to be served
- Created a personalization preview application
- Designed a new product update methodology replacing a system with a new live system including built in error handling and redundancy
Environment: ERP, Commerce Server, Oracle, Reporting Services